JACKSON HEIGHTS, QUEENS — A motorcyclist was killed in Jackson Heights early Sunday morning after he collided with a Jeep, police said.

The 25-year-old man was speeding west on 31st Avenue about 4:30 a.m. when he crashed into a Jeep Grand Cherokee heading north on 83rd Street, according to police.

EMS pronounced the motorcyclist dead on the scene.

The Jeep's 52-year-old driver survived unscathed, the New York Post reported.

There are no arrests.
